Replatforming projects often encounter significant issues: loss of organic traffic, incomplete data transfers, broken integrations, and SEO damage. These problems frequently surface during the cutover phase, leading to costly delays and degraded customer experience. An independent pre-migration risk scan, which can be performed by specialized tools or agencies, aims to surface these risks early, allowing for targeted remediation before the live switch.

The proposed risk assessment involves connecting to the source store via URL crawl and API access, then generating a comprehensive report. This report includes a URL and redirect inventory with a 301 mapping plan, an analysis of SEO assets such as metadata and internal linking, a dependency map of apps and integrations, flags for custom fields and data completeness, and an estimated risk score for traffic disruption and downtime. This process helps merchants and agencies scope projects more accurately and reduce unexpected issues during migration.

Market interest is rising as only about 14% of merchants are satisfied with their current platform, and 77% plan to migrate within a year, according to Swell. Many migrations are driven by end-of-life deadlines for platforms like Magento 1 or legacy editions. Automated migration tools handle only around 50-60% of the process, creating a clear need for an independent risk assessment layer to de-risk these projects. The Growing Need for Risk-Aware Replatforming

Replatforming to Shopify or BigCommerce is becoming more common due to platform end-of-life deadlines, such as Magento 1, and widespread dissatisfaction with existing systems. Currently, only a small percentage of merchants are fully satisfied with their platforms, and a majority plan to migrate within the next year. Automated migration tools, while helpful, only cover part of the process, leaving gaps that can cause serious issues during cutover. This context underscores the importance of a pre-migration risk assessment, which is still emerging but gaining traction among agencies and mid-market merchants.

Key Questions

What is a pre-migration risk scan?

A pre-migration risk scan is a comprehensive assessment that identifies potential issues—such as broken links, SEO risks, and data gaps—before switching to a new e-commerce platform like Shopify or BigCommerce.

Who should consider using a risk scan?

Mid-market merchants planning to migrate, along with their agencies and partners, should consider risk scans to minimize project risks and ensure a smoother transition.

How does the risk scan work?

The scan connects to the source store via URL crawl and API access, then generates a detailed report covering URL redirects, SEO assets, app dependencies, custom fields, and traffic risk estimates.

Is this approach widely available now?

The concept is currently being tested with early pilots. Widespread adoption depends on validation of its effectiveness and cost-efficiency in real-world projects.

What are the main benefits of conducting a risk scan?

Risk scans help identify issues early, reduce unexpected downtime, improve SEO preservation, and enable better project scoping, ultimately increasing the likelihood of a successful migration.
